        AFAIK, Testdisk is mainly for the lost partitions restore. It can also undelete deleted files from some (but not any) filesystems.

        Quote from the https://www.cgsecurity.org/wiki/TestDisk site:

        TestDisk is powerful free data recovery software! It was primarily designed to help recover lost partitions and/or make non-booting disks bootable again when these symptoms are caused by faulty software: certain types of viruses or human error (such as accidentally deleting a Partition Table). Partition table recovery using TestDisk is really easy.

        TestDisk can

        – Fix partition table, recover deleted partition
        – Recover FAT32 boot sector from its backup
        – Rebuild FAT12/FAT16/FAT32 boot sector
        – Fix FAT tables
        – Rebuild NTFS boot sector
        – Recover NTFS boot sector from its backup
        – Fix MFT using MFT mirror
        – Locate ext2/ext3/ext4 Backup SuperBlock
        – Undelete files from FAT, exFAT, NTFS and ext2 filesystem
        – Copy files from deleted FAT, exFAT, NTFS and ext2/ext3/ext4 partitions.
